Jean-Claude Van Damme returns as cybernetic warrior Luc Deveraux in this sequel to the 1992 action hit. After barely surviving his experiences as a part-human/part-robot Universal Soldier, Luc has opt... read more read more...ed to stay out of the front lines and work with a military project to refine and perfect the system. However, something goes wrong (as they so often do in films like this), and S.E.T.H. (Michael Jai White), the android supercomputer leading the new breed of soldiers, suddenly develops a murderous mind of his own. Soon S.E.T.H. is leading his fellow war machines on a rampage, and Luc is the only one who can stop them. The supporting cast includes Heidi Schanz and wrestling star Bill Goldberg. ~ Mark Deming, Rovi

    "Universal Soldier: The Return" isn't what you think it might be if you saw the original Universal Soldier movie that starred Van Damme. Jean-Claude Van Damme is not one of the universal soldiers in this movie, he's a human going up against many evil universal soldiers including ... read morewrestling star, Goldberg, and Seth (martial artist, Michael Jai White).
    "Universal Soldier: The Return" isn't really a good movie, but it does have a lot of good special effects, and fighting sequences. The first 50 minutes of the movie isn't that great, but the last 40 minutes of the movie is some of the best action and fighting sequences I've seen in awhile. If you like Van Damme movies or movies with some good action, I recommend seeing "Universal Soldier: The Return."
